Product Detailed Parameters

  • Description:SENSOR PHOTO 940NM SIDE VIEW SMD
  • Series:WL-STSW
  • Mfr:Würth Elektronik
  • Package:Tape & Reel (TR),Cut Tape (CT)
  • Voltage - Collector Emitter Breakdown (Max):35 V
  • Current - Dark (Id) (Max):100 nA
  • Wavelength:940nm
  • Viewing Angle:150°
  • Power - Max:150 mW
  • Mounting Type:Surface Mount
  • Orientation:Side View
  • Operating Temperature:-40°C ~ 85°C
  • Package / Case:2-SMD, No Lead
  • Current - Collector (Ic) (Max):20 mA
  • Grade:-
  • Qualification:-
